Job Summary

As the Data Analyst, you will play a critical role in assessing the new SFTP setup for the client project and evaluating the current architecture and reporting systems.

Job Description

We are seeking a Data Analyst play a critical role in assessing the new SFTP setup for the client project and evaluating the current architecture and reporting systems. This position will be full-time and remote.

What You’ll Do

Evaluate SFTP Setup: Assess the implementation of the new SFTP system, ensuring it meets project and security requirements

Identify potential gaps or risks and provide solutions to optimize performance

Review the current data architecture, including how data is stored, transferred, and processed across agencies involved in the NJEASEL project

Evaluate existing reports, ensuring that they align with project goals and compliance requirements

Recommend improvements in reporting processes and methods of data visualization

Ensure data transferred through the SFTP system is accurate, secure, and complete. Implement data validation techniques and suggest ways to improve data quality

Work closely with other project team members, including data engineers, IT staff, and business analysts, to gather requirements and deliver insights

Prepare documentation on findings, assessments, and recommendations for optimizing the current data system

Provide actionable insights to enhance the overall efficiency of the NJEASEL data processes
